The ARRL will perform product reviews when they are provided a review sample and when they have the resources available to perform it. Not in this world will they ever have the resources to keep re-testing current production samples of all rigs whenever a new one emerges. I was under the impression that ARRL buys the equipment they reveiw, and then auction it off later. This is so they get a regular off the production line rig instead of a special carefully tweaked rig for the reveiw. I did not think the rigs were "provided" to the ARRL in any way other than being sold to them. Ken N6KB |
